Michael BolinandGitHub 66533ddc61 mcp: remove codex/sandbox-state custom request support (#17957)
## Why

#17763 moved sandbox-state delivery for MCP tool calls to request
`_meta` via the `codex/sandbox-state-meta` experimental capability.
Keeping the older `codex/sandbox-state` capability meant Codex still
maintained a second transport that pushed updates with the custom
`codex/sandbox-state/update` request at server startup and when the
session sandbox policy changed.

That duplicate MCP path is redundant with the per-tool-call metadata
path and makes the sandbox-state contract larger than needed. The
existing managed network proxy refresh on sandbox-policy changes is
still needed, so this keeps that behavior separate from the removed MCP
notification.

## What Changed

- Removed the exported `MCP_SANDBOX_STATE_CAPABILITY` and
`MCP_SANDBOX_STATE_METHOD` constants.
- Removed detection of `codex/sandbox-state` during MCP initialization
and stopped sending `codex/sandbox-state/update` at server startup.
- Removed the `McpConnectionManager::notify_sandbox_state_change`
plumbing while preserving the managed network proxy refresh when a user
turn changes sandbox policy.
- Slimmed `McpConnectionManager::new` so startup paths pass only the
initial `SandboxPolicy` needed for MCP elicitation state.
- Kept `codex/sandbox-state-meta` support intact; servers that opt in
still receive the current `SandboxState` on tool-call request `_meta`
([remaining call
path](https://github.com/openai/codex/blob/ff2d3c1e72ff08ce13743b99605d19d338edd51c/codex-rs/core/src/mcp_tool_call.rs#L487-L526)).
- Added regression coverage for refreshing the live managed network
proxy on a per-turn sandbox-policy change.

Ruslan NigmatullinandGitHub 83abf67d20 app-server: track remote-control seq IDs per stream (#17902)
## Summary

- Track outbound remote-control sequence IDs independently for each
client stream.
- Retain unacked outbound messages per stream using FIFO buffers.
- Require stream-scoped acks and update tests for contiguous per-stream
sequencing.

## Why

The remote-control peer uses outbound sequence gaps to detect lost
messages and re-initialize. A single global outbound sequence counter
can create apparent gaps on an individual stream when another stream
receives an interleaved message.

78ce61c78e Fix empty tool descriptions (#17946)
## Summary
- Ensure direct namespaced MCP tool groups are emitted with a non-empty
namespace description even when namespace metadata is missing or blank.
- Add regression coverage for missing MCP namespace descriptions.

## Cause
Latest `main` can serialize a direct namespaced MCP tool group with an
empty top-level `description`. The namespace description path used
`unwrap_or_default()` when `tool_namespaces` did not include metadata
for that namespace, so the outbound Responses API payload could contain
a tool like `{"type":"namespace","description":""}`. The Responses API
rejects that because namespace tool descriptions must be a non-empty
string.

## Fix
- Add a fallback namespace description: `Tools in the <namespace>
namespace.`
- Preserve provided namespace descriptions after trimming, but treat
blank descriptions as missing.

Michael BolinandGitHub d34bc66466 sandbox: remove dead seatbelt helper and update tests (#17859)
## Why

`spawn_command_under_seatbelt()` in `codex-rs/core/src/seatbelt.rs` had
fallen out of production use and was only referenced by test-only
wrappers. That left us with sandbox tests that could stay green even if
the actual seatbelt exec path regressed, because production shell
execution now flows through `SandboxManager::transform()` and
`ExecRequest::from_sandbox_exec_request()` instead of that helper.

Removing the dead helper also exposed one downstream `codex-exec`
integration test that still imported it, which broke `just clippy`.

## What Changed

- Removed `codex-rs/core/src/seatbelt.rs` and stopped exporting
`codex_core::seatbelt`.
- Removed the redundant `codex-rs/core/tests/suite/seatbelt.rs` coverage
that only exercised the dead helper.
- Kept the `openpty` regression check, but moved it into
`codex-rs/core/tests/suite/exec.rs` so it now runs through
`process_exec_tool_call()`.
- Fixed the seatbelt denial test in `codex-rs/core/tests/suite/exec.rs`
to use `/usr/bin/touch`, so it actually exercises the sandbox instead of
a nonexistent path.
- Updated `codex-rs/exec/tests/suite/sandbox.rs` on macOS to build the
sandboxed command through `build_exec_request()` and spawn the
transformed command, instead of importing the removed helper.
- Left the lower-level seatbelt policy coverage in
`codex-rs/sandboxing/src/seatbelt_tests.rs`, where the policy generator
is still covered directly.

706f830dc6 Fix remote skill popup loading (#17702)
## Summary

Fix the TUI `$` skill popup so personal skills appear reliably when
Codex is connected to a remote app-server.

## What changed

- load skills on TUI startup with an explicit forced refresh
- refresh skills using the actual current cwd instead of an empty `cwds`
list
- resync an already-open `$` popup when skill mentions are updated
- add a regression test for refreshing an open mention popup

## Root cause

The TUI was sometimes sending `list_skills` with `cwds: []` after
`SessionConfigured`.

For the launchd app-server flow, the server resolved that empty cwd list
to its own process cwd, which was `/`. The response therefore came back
tagged with `cwd: "/"`, and the TUI later filtered skills by exact cwd
match against the actual project cwd such as `/Users/starr/code/dream`.
That dropped all personal skills from the mention list, so `$` only
showed plugins/apps.

## Verification
